Word is that Apple is getting ready to drop the iPod Classic and Shuffle, and there have been rumors of them dropping the iPod line entirely. Last report I read said something along the lines of iPods only making up about 7% of Apples revenue now, and with the iPhone and iPad doing everything the iPod did (and more) there's not enough $$ in it anymore.
